Quantum Training

Dr Jurij Alschitz opens an international further education programme for acting teachers and theatre pedagogues and thus passes on his many years of research on Quantum Pedagogy in its entirety to the next generation. The idea is to fundamentally innovate and re-evaluate acting education.

Quantum training builds the bridge between natural sciences and art; it sees teaching as a creative act and teachers as artists.

Actors and directors – all who feel ready for this are welcome in this programme. Quantum Training for Theatre  is first and foremost an individual reorientation for one’s own artistic work.

The qualification programme consists of 22 weekly online meetings, 4 of which are in-depth practical courses with Dr Olga Lapina and Christine Schmalor.

16 October 2022 – 26 March 2023.
Anyone who is unable to attend can watch the recording.
Additional live meetings are planned for the final in Italy/Berlin.

Graduates will receive a certificate from the World Theatre Training Institute AKT-ZENT | Research Centre of the International Theatre Institute.
